How they compare
Tunisia currently reports 11.4% against 9.3% in Andorra, a difference of 2.1%.
That makes Tunisia's figure about 1.2 times Andorra's.
Across all 8 years both countries report, Tunisia has been ahead every year.
Andorra ranks 5th and Tunisia ranks 2nd of 121 countries.
Tunisia has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.
